#660b2f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#660b2f is composed of 40% red, 4.3% green and 18.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.2% magenta, 53.9%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 336.3 degrees, a saturation of 80.5% and a lightness of 22.2%. #660b2f color hex could be obtained by blending #cc165e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

#660b2f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#660b2f has RGB values of R:102, G:11, B:47 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.89, Y:0.54,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 6687535.

Shades and Tints of #660b2f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0106 is the darkest color, while #fffb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#660b2f
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b3638 is the less saturated color, while #6f022d is the most saturated one.
